Two children weighing 40 lbs and 50 lbs each are balancing their teacher weighing 120 lbs on a seesaw. The teacher is sitting 5

feet from the fulcrum, and the child weighing 50 lbs is seated 8 feet from the fulcrum. Find the distance (in feet) from the fulcrum where the child weighing 40 lbs should taker her place.

Answer:

5 feet

Explanation:

First lets imagine that the values are in meters and kg, to make it easier for me.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

The force created by the teacher is 120 × 5 = 600N.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

The force created by the 50 kg student is 50 × 8 = 400N

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

The force that needs to be created by the 40 kg student is 600N - 400N = 200N.

To create that force that student needs to sit 200 ÷ 40 = 5m.

So the 40 lbs student is sitting 5 feet from the fulcrum.
